MANILA, Philippines - Malacañang criticized Vice President Sara Duterte for joking about giving "free advice" to the Marcos administration on how to solve the country’s flood problem.
In a text message, Palace Press Officer Claire Castro said the vice president should give her advice to her brother, acting Davao City Mayor Sebastian Duterte, if she has the solutions as a result of her frequent trips abroad.

"The vice president doesn't want to give free advice for the country?! If she has learned a solution to the country's flooding problem through her various travels, she should give her free advice to acting Mayor Baste of Davao City," Castro said in Filipino.
